When you talk to Miah Riyuh for the 'last' time: if you select the answer "Sorry, but I'm having second thoughts." the quest will drop out of your 'current quest' log but will NOT be added to you 'completed' log. Also, if you change your mind and talk to Miah Riyuh again, you will NOT have to get a new 'invitation' however you WILL have to run back to all three towers. AnonRamuh 04:11, 25 November 2007 (UTC)
